zkSync 2.0: ইথেরিয়াম স্কেলিংয়ের নতুন অধ্যায়

by:BlockchainMaven1 সপ্তাহ আগে
1.73K
zkSync 2.0: ইথেরিয়াম স্কেলিংয়ের নতুন অধ্যায়

ইথেরিয়াম স্কেলিং বিপ্লব শুরু হয়েছে

ভাইটালিক যখন প্রথম ব্লকচেইন ট্রাইলেমা প্রস্তাব করেছিলেন, তখন তিনি হয়তো চতুর্থ মাত্রার জন্য সমাধান করার প্রয়োজনীয়তা anticipate করেননি: প্রোগ্রামেবিলিটি। যেহেতু আমি অসংখ্য স্কেলিং সমাধান আসতে এবং যেতে দেখেছি, আমি আত্মবিশ্বাসের সাথে বলতে পারি যে zkSync 2.0 মৌলিকভাবে কিছু আলাদা প্রতিনিধিত্ব করে।

টেক স্ট্যাক ভেঙে দেখা

এখানে মুকুটযুক্ত রত্ন হল তাদের zkEVM বাস্তবায়ন - একটি ক্রিপ্টোগ্রাফিক marvel যে স্মার্ট চুক্তি executes যখন জিরো-নলেজ প্রুফ তৈরি করে। আমার জন্য সবচেয়ে আকর্ষণীয় বিষয় হল কিভাবে তারা EVM সামঞ্জস্য বজায় রেখেছে প্রুফ জেনারেশন দক্ষতার জন্য optimize করে। তাদের পদ্ধতি আমাকে ওয়াল স্ট্রিট কোয়ান্ট মডেলের কথা মনে করিয়ে দেয় - জটিল গণিত ব্যবহারিক করা হয়েছে।

মূল উপাদানগুলির মধ্যে রয়েছে:

  • সম্পূর্ণ zkEVM নির্দেশনা সেট (ইন-সার্কিট এবং এক্সিকিউশন এনভায়রনমেন্ট উভয়ই)
  • Solidity/Zinc থেকে zkEVM বাইটকোড কম্পাইলার
  • চুক্তি deployment জন্য সম্পূর্ণ নোড ইন্টিগ্রেশন

ডেভেলপারদের জন্য এটি কেন গুরুত্বপূর্ণ

অধিকাংশ অপারেশন ইথেরিয়াম ডেভেলপারদের কাছে পরিচিত মনে হবে, কিছু ইচ্ছাকৃত ব্যতিক্রম সহ:

  1. ADDMOD/SMOD অপ্স মত সাময়িক exclusions (পরবর্তীতে আসছে)
  2. KECCAK256 temporarily collision-resistant alternatives দ্বারা প্রতিস্থাপিত
  3. SELFDESTRUCT নেই (ইথেরিয়াম এর নেতৃত্ব অনুসরণ করে)

গ্যাস মডেল বিশেষভাবে উদ্ভাবনী - L1 গ্যাস মূল্য এবং ZKP প্রজন্ম খরচ উপর ভিত্তি করে dynamically adjusting. Ethereum’s predictability ব্যবহার করা developers জন্য, এটি কিছু adjustment প্রয়োজন হবে.

গোপন সস: zkPorter ইন্টিগ্রেশন

এখানে বিষয়গুলি brilliant হয়ে ওঠে। zkPorter একটি off-chain ডেটা availability সিস্টেম প্রদান করে যা throughput দুই order of magnitude দ্বারা বৃদ্ধি করে। এই ছবিটি কল্পনা করুন:

  • zkRollup অ্যাকাউন্ট (সর্বাধিক নিরাপত্তা)
  • zkPorter অ্যাকাউন্ট (কম খরচ)

সমস্ত একই state tree মধ্যে interoperable. এটি একটি ফ্লাইটে first-class এবং economy আসন থাকার মত - বিভিন্ন মূল্য পয়েন্ট, একই গন্তব্য.

ক্রিপ্টোগ্রাফিক হুড অধীনে

আমরা দেখছি:

  • Battle-tested PLONK proof system
  • Custom gates/lookup tables (UltraPLONK)
  • Ethereum’s BN-254 curve

Circuit and execution environments মধ্যে পৃথকীকরণ বিশেষভাবে clever - finalization times practical রাখার সময় security বজায় রাখা.

এর পরে কি?

dev team এখন ফোকাস করছে:

  1. কম্পাইলার robustness
  2. Recursive proof aggregation
  3. Zinc language enhancements
  4. Potential Rust compiler frontend

dev team এখন ফোকাস করছে:

BlockchainMaven

লাইক70.19K অনুসারক1.58K
বিটকয়েন
অপুলাস